TICKET-4417: Signature check failed on autocomplete index build

For weekly sync: the nightly build of the Lumehaven autocomplete index failed signature verification on two mirror nodes. Root cause was the index artifact being re-signed with the retired January key after a cache restore. Index rebuild is slow (~4h), so we'll re-sign the existing artifact rather than rebuild. Verification should use the current deploy key, shown below.

deploy key for kajof-fajop: bky6_gDHw9Q

Ticket #—Missed pick-up, blueprints for the Harrowfield annex building permit. Yesterday's courier from Stonegate Permitting did not arrive by the 15:00 cutoff, so the tube set remains in the records cage. A replacement pick-up is booked for tomorrow morning. Please keep the tubes sealed with the permit cover sheet attached; the municipal office will reject opened sets. Release the tubes only after the courier recites this phrase:

handover note for tadug-yaguf: the aldath pelwyn courier leaves the casox norwyn briix silok zorok kasdor aldion quenox ledger at gate 2653 under passcode 959015

Each rule declares a severity, a dialect scope, and an autofix capability flag; misdeclaring any of these will cause your plugin to be rejected at load time. Pay particular attention to how the Vexley dialect handles quoted identifiers, as several built-in rules special-case it. The complete rule catalogue, including deprecation timelines and naming conventions for third-party rule IDs, is documented on the internal reference page below.

dashboard of tawef-yageg = https://jira.torvaworks.corp/deploy/merge_requests/board/settings/issue/settings/build/86c86b97dff3e2041bd6f497

Welcome to the Fernwhistle webhook crew! Quick primer on retries: when a delivery fails, we back off exponentially — 30s, 2m, 10m, then hourly for a day. After 24 attempts we park the event in the dead-letter queue and ping the on-call channel. Don't "fix" this by tightening the schedule; partner endpoints flap constantly and they hate being hammered. Retries are signed so receivers can verify it's really us. Add the signing secret to your local env file on the next line.

sealed setting: ARCHIVE_KEY3=8d0